Photoshoot Images

In this Animoto, I have put a collection of good images together that I took of my model during our photoshoot.


I think these are great photos that I could use for my magazine, website and billboard, this way it keeps synergy throughout my products, and lets the reader know that its the same main story by the images used. I would regard these as usable images because they are bright and the model looks happy in them. I wanted my model to look relaxed, but also have an invitational facial expression so it would draw my primary target audience in. I made not to choose a model that would stereotypically be my target audience, as I want my readers to feel like they can connect with her.

Below are some images that I would regard as unusable.



This is a long mid shot, and the model is smiling in a relaxed pose. Although the model looks happy and carefree, the feelings I want my model to portray to the audience, the lighting is too dark, and will make my products look dull and boring.





In this image, the model is looking behind her shoulder towards the camera, again in a casual position. I think this image would of worked great for the double page spread, although because it is so dark, it is unusable.
The similar situation happened here, the lighting is too dark, and will not be used for my products.
